Čakovec invests 2.5 million euros in SRC Mladost revitalization

The city of Čakovec is progressing with a major urban revitalization project titled ‘ITU – Revitalization of the 3rd Zone of Active Living’. The project, valued at nearly 2.5 million euros, aims to transform the southern part of the SRC Mladost sports center into a modern sports, recreational, and social hub.

Located adjacent to the Marija Ružić City Pools, the development includes a new parking lot with 165 spaces, internal roads, and solar-powered canopies to provide sustainable infrastructure. Key features of the site will include an amphitheater with a stage for concerts and cinema screenings, a new promenade, an outdoor gym, a large children's playground, a dog park, picnic areas, a yoga park, an aromatic garden, and a sledding hill.

To promote energy efficiency, the area will be equipped with smart solutions such as solar trees, solar benches, information totems, and solar lighting. Mayor Ljerka Cividini, who recently inspected the site, described the project as one of the city’s most ambitious investments in public space. Construction is currently in the realization phase, with earthworks completed and reinforced concrete work on the amphitheater stands underway.
